开通会员
  • 尊享所有功能
  • 文件大小最高200M
  • 文件无水印
  • 尊贵VIP身份
  • VIP专属服务
  • 历史记录保存30天云存储
开通会员
您的位置:首页 > 帮助中心 > qt网络编程 pdf_Qt网络编程的关键技术解析
默认会员免费送
帮助中心 >

qt网络编程 pdf_Qt网络编程的关键技术解析

2024-12-18 05:41:44
qt网络编程 pdf_qt网络编程的关键技术解析
《qt网络编程之pdf概述》

qt为网络编程提供了强大的功能支持。在网络编程中涉及pdf相关内容也有着独特的意义。

首先,qt可用于构建网络应用来获取pdf资源。通过其网络模块,能发送http请求到存储pdf的服务器端,高效地下载pdf文件。例如,在开发电子图书阅读器的网络功能时,可利用qt的网络功能从远程服务器获取各种pdf书籍。

同时,qt的跨平台特性使得基于网络的pdf处理能够在不同操作系统上实现统一的效果。无论是windows、linux还是mac。并且,qt可在网络通信过程中对pdf数据进行安全传输,保证数据完整性。这对于需要在网络中传递pdf文档的企业办公应用等场景至关重要。总之,qt网络编程为pdf相关应用的网络交互奠定了坚实基础。

qt网络编程详解

qt网络编程详解
## 《qt网络编程详解

qt提供了丰富的网络编程类,便于开发各种网络应用。

在qt网络编程中,`qtcpsocket`和`qtcpserver`是进行tcp编程的关键类。`qtcpserver`用于创建服务器,监听指定端口,当有客户端连接请求时,可接受连接并创建`qtcpsocket`实例与之通信。`qtcpsocket`则负责与服务器或客户端之间的数据收发。

对于udp通信,`qudpsocket`类可以实现。它既能发送数据报,也能接收来自任何源的udp数据报。

此外,qt的网络模块支持ssl加密通信,确保数据传输的安全性。通过信号和槽机制,能方便地处理网络事件,如连接成功、数据到达、连接断开等,大大简化了网络编程的复杂性,提高开发效率。

qt网络编程默认缓冲区多大

qt网络编程默认缓冲区多大
《qt网络编程中的默认缓冲区大小》

在qt网络编程中,默认缓冲区大小是一个重要的概念。对于qtcpsocket等网络相关类,并没有明确公开一个固定数值作为绝对的默认缓冲区大小。

其缓冲区大小受多种因素影响。一方面,系统底层的网络协议栈设置会对其产生影响,不同操作系统可能有自己的默认网络缓冲区策略。另一方面,qt自身在进行网络数据传输时,会根据网络状况动态调整缓存策略。

通常情况下,qt会尽量优化缓冲区的使用,以确保数据能够高效地在网络中传输。在开发过程中,如果需要特定的缓冲区大小来满足诸如实时性、大数据量传输等特殊需求,开发人员可以通过相关的api进行自定义设置,以确保网络应用的稳定性和高效性。

qt网络编程和python

qt网络编程和python
## 《qt网络编程与python》

qt是一个强大的跨平台框架,其网络编程功能在构建网络应用方面表现卓越。而python以简洁、高效著称。

在qt网络编程中,可以方便地创建tcp、udp套接字等进行网络通信。例如构建服务器与客户端的交互系统。python则借助众多库,如`socket`库实现基础网络操作。

将qt网络编程与python结合有独特优势。python可以利用qt的网络功能构建图形化网络工具。通过pyqt库,python代码能够无缝调用qt网络相关类。开发人员可以在python简洁语法下,快速构建基于qt网络能力的复杂应用,如网络监测工具、简易聊天软件等,同时享受qt的跨平台特性,在不同操作系统下高效运行。
您已连续签到 0 天,当前积分:0
  • 第1天
    积分+10
  • 第2天
    积分+10
  • 第3天
    积分+10
  • 第4天
    积分+10
  • 第5天
    积分+10
  • 第6天
    积分+10
  • 第7天

    连续签到7天

    获得积分+10

获得10积分

明天签到可得10积分

咨询客服

扫描二维码,添加客服微信